Abstract

The present invention provides a kind of mobile terminal, it include: display screen, ontology, shell and NFC antenna, the shell includes housing section and side frame, the display screen, the ontology and the housing section are stacked, the side frame is connected between the housing section and the display screen, the NFC antenna is received in the accommodating space between the ontology and the side frame, or the NFC antenna is contained in the side far from the housing section of the ontology, the display screen is passed through in the signal transmitting and receiving path of the NFC antenna.The present invention is by by the setting of NFC antenna, the space between the ontology of mobile terminal and shell can be made full use of, it can satisfy the lightening requirement of mobile terminal, when mobile terminal uses metal shell, it is swiped the card by the display screen side in mobile terminal, the signal of NFC antenna will not be transmitted by metal shell, therefore metal shell is not necessarily to crack, and then can improve the globality of metal appearance.

Background technique
NFC (Near Field Communication) is also known as wireless near field communication, be a kind of short-range high frequency without Line communication technology.Since antenna identification is apart from short, low energy consumption, the various features such as safety height, it has also become more and more logical Believe the object of manufacturer's research and development and production.Existing NFC antenna mostly uses coil form, is made on flexible printed circuit board, then It is integrated in inside hand held electronic terminals or on shell.
With the designer trends that the mobile terminals such as mobile phone are lightening, in the prior art, NFC antenna can be attached to mobile whole On the plastic shell at end, this will increase the thickness of mobile terminal.Simultaneously as metal shell (the example of mobile terminal such as mobile phone Such as metal battery cover) become a kind of trend, but since metal shell can shield electromagnetic radiation, so needing to open on metal shell Hole is so that NFC antenna radiation signal is gone out by metal shell side, in this way, will affect the globality of metal appearance.

Referring to Fig.1, mobile terminal according to the present invention includes display screen 1, ontology 2, shell 3 and NFC antenna 4, wherein outer Shell 3 includes housing section 31 and side frame 32, and display screen 1, ontology 2 and housing section 31 are stacked, and side frame 32 is connected to housing section 31 Between display screen 1, NFC antenna 4 is received in the accommodating space between ontology 2 and side frame 32.In Fig. 1, the accommodating Space includes the first space A and second space B for two short side walls for being respectively adjacent to ontology 2, and NFC antenna 4 is contained in the first sky Between in A, without being attached in housing section 31, so as to make full use of the space between display screen 1 and shell 3, Ke Yiman The lightening requirement of sufficient mobile terminal, and the signal of NFC antenna will not be transmitted via ontology 2, for including plastic shell Mobile terminal, user can be swiped the card with the two sides of mobile terminal, and for the mobile terminal including metal shell, by The 1 side brush card of display screen of mobile terminal, the signal of NFC antenna are not necessarily to transmit by metal shell, therefore metal shell is without opening Seam, and then the globality of metal appearance can be improved.Certainly, in Fig. 1, NFC antenna 4 can also be contained in second space B. Certainly, NFC antenna 4 can also be contained in the region in addition to the first space A and second space B of accommodating space.
The mobile terminal provided by the invention can be a portable electronic device or communication device, for example, intelligent hand Machine, personal digital assistant (Personal Digital Assistant, abbreviation PDA), tablet computer, notebook, POS machine, very It is without being limited thereto to can be vehicle-mounted computer.The mobile terminal not only can talk, and takes pictures, listens to music, playing game, and can be with Realize to include positioning, information processing, finger scan, identity card scanning, bar code scan, RFID scanning, IC card scanning and alcohol The functions such as content detection.
In this embodiment, which is touch-control display module or touch panel component, and includes at least display mould Group, touch-control sensing unit and protection glass, wherein protection glass is located at outermost layer.In other embodiments, which is The display screen structure of the mobile terminal, and include at least display module and protection glass, wherein protection glass is located at outermost layer.
Above-mentioned NFC is the abbreviation of Near Field Communication, i.e. near-field communication technology, is a kind of contactless Identification and interconnection technique, can carry out near radio between mobile device, consumer electronics product, PC and smart control tool Communication exchanges information, access content and service in which can allow consumer's simple, intuitive.NFC includes NFC module and NFC antenna 4, Wherein, NFC module is generally made of a high-speed microprocessor, radio frequency chip and match circuit.
Referring to Fig. 2, NFC antenna 4 can also be arranged in the groove 21 of the side far from housing section 31 of ontology 2, and NFC days Display screen 1 is passed through in the signal transmitting and receiving path of line, and this arrangement can make full use of the space between display screen 1 and ontology 2, It can satisfy the lightening requirement of mobile terminal, in addition, when mobile terminal uses metal shell, it can be in the aobvious of mobile terminal The signal of display screen side brush card, NFC antenna will not be transmitted by metal shell, therefore metal shell is not necessarily to crack, and then can change Into the globality of metal appearance.Certainly, the side of the separate housing section 31 of ontology 2 is not necessarily to be equipped with groove, and NFC antenna 4 is contained in Display screen 1 is passed through in the signal transmitting and receiving path of the side far from housing section 31 of ontology 2, NFC antenna 4.
Preferably, the housing section 31 and 32 integrated molding of side frame.It is appreciated that the side frame 32 is around housing section 31 Surrounding is bent towards 1 side of display screen to be extended, and the housing section 31 and the side frame 32 are identical material, for example, be metal, Plastics or composite material.Such as the housing section 12 and the side frame 32 are metal, shield the radiation signal of the NFC antenna 4. In other embodiments, the housing section 31 is not identical as the material of the side frame 32, such as the housing section 31 is metal and the side frame 32 be plastics etc., is not listed one by one herein.
Preferably, which is fixedly connected with the side frame 32.It is appreciated that 31 side of being connected by a snap of housing section Formula achieves a fixed connection with the side frame 32, or is achieved a fixed connection using screw.And the housing section 31 is phase with the side frame 32 Same material, such as be metal, plastics or composite material.In this embodiment, the housing section 31 and the side frame 32 are gold Belong to, shields the radiation signal of the NFC antenna 40.In other embodiments, the material of the housing section 31 and the side frame 32 not phase Together, for example, the housing section 31 is metal and the side frame 32 is plastics etc., be not listed one by one herein.Further, mobile terminal Ontology 2 include circuit board (not shown) and the battery (not shown) with circuit board electrical connection, NFC antenna 4 include antenna body (not Show) and transfer element (not shown), antenna body be received in the accommodating space between ontology 2 and side frame 32, or Antenna body is contained in the side far from housing section 31 of ontology 2, and display screen 1 is passed through in the signal transmitting and receiving path of NFC antenna 4., pass Circuit board of the defeated element respectively with antenna body and ontology 2 is electrically coupled.The antenna body of NFC antenna includes that substrate and setting exist The metal layer of upper surface of base plate.Wherein, which can be made up of coiling, printing or etching mode, for using print Brush technology mode, specifically, printing technology manufacture antenna are to pass through net using electrically conductive ink (materials such as carbon slurry, silver paste, copper slurry) Version is directly printed on insulating substrate, and is solidified using suitable temperature, is formed the conducting wire of antenna, that is, is formed the day Line ontology.For specifically using polyester film as insulating substrate, using the dedicated resin of soft board using etch process mode Glue presses together aluminium foil (copper foil) with polyester film, forms the conductive base with metal layer, passes through patch photosensitive dry film or silk It prints photosensitive-ink and is used as resistant layer, using exposure, imaging, etch, move back membrane process and produce figure route, then pass through riveting side Formula realizes the connection of two sides line circuit, that is, forms the antenna body.
In other embodiments, which can also realize in the following ways, specifically, using flexible circuit board Technique manufactures the antenna body of NFC antenna 4, mainly using polyimides double-sided copper-clad paper tinsel base material and ink for screen printing welding resistance or polyamides Imines PI membrane material is made, and makes conductor wire by the processes such as engineering design, sawing sheet, drilling, heavy electrolytic copper, pad pasting exposure, DES line Road guarantees the insulation performance and weldability energy of product by welding resistance pad pasting or printing ink printing art and surface treatment, and uses LCR resistance test guarantees the consistency of product every batch of performance, and separately can be with individually designed test fixture, simulation test antenna Distance of reaction, it is ensured that the reliability and products application function of properties of product are realized.
